Liquicap M FMI51 HART Mounting The maximum cable length L4 and rod length L1 cannot exceed 10 m (33 ft). The maximum cable length between the probe and separate housing is 6 m (20 ft). The required cable length must be indicated in the ordering process of a Liquicap M with separate housing.

Electrical connection Liquicap M FMI51 HART 5.1.2 Electromagnetic compatibility (EMC) Interference emission to EN 61326, Electrical Equipment Class B. Interference immunity to EN 61326, Annex A (Industrial) and NAMUR Recommendation NE 21 (EMC). Failure current is in accordance with NAMUR NE43: FEI50H = 22 mA.
